John Shoenhair
14 November 1876 --- 14 July 1941

John Shoenhair, 64, died at his home on South Commercial Avenue Monday morning, July 14. He has been suffering from a partial stroke of paralysis for about three years.

Funeral services were held Wednesday afternoon with the Rev. J. R. Tumbleson in charge, at the Kubitschek & Kastler Funeral home. Burial was in Rose Hill cemetery.

Obituary

John Shoenhair, son of John and Lena Shoenhair, was born in Lenox, Iowa, Nov. 14, 1876. When he was 14 years of age the family moved to Guthrie, Okla., where he lived until 1900, when he returned to Iowa and made his home with his brother, George, at Iowa Falls.

On Nov. 20, 1907, he was united in marriage with Miss Ethel McCormick at Clemens, Iowa. They lived in Clemens until they moved to a farm west of Eagle Grove in February 1912 and lived there for four years. Since then, they have made their home in this city. To this union were born three sons, John James of Pittsburgh, Pa., and Richard and Robert who are still at home.

About three years ago Mr. Shoenhair suffered a paralytic stroke from which he did not entirely recover. On Monday morning he was stricken again and passed away in the afternoon.

Besides his sons there remain his wife, Ethel; four sisters, Anna Shoenhair, Mrs. Rosa McKean, Mrs. Sarah McPherson of Guthrie, Okla., Mrs. Amelia Speer, Olathe, Kans., four brothers, George and Sam of California, Will of Muskogee, Okla., and Frank of Eagle Grove. Two other brothers, James and Charles, preceded him in death.

Mr. Shoenhair was baptized and joined the Christian church in 1907. Upon coming to Eagle Grove, he united with the Methodist church of which he was a member until the time of his death. He was for many years a member of I.O.O.F in Guthrie, Okla., and later in Eagle Grove.

EAGLE GROVE EAGLE --- Eagle Grove, Iowa
Thursday, July 17, 1941
